APTN Library

LONDON: Associated Press Television News (APTN) Library will begin archiving Sports News Television (SNTV) programming from January 2003.

APTN will be archiving SNTV's daily output of six sports bulletins each day and also catalogue material dating back to 1996.

The two companies will also produce themed clipreels from SNTV's backdated catalogue. They are expected to feature 'bizarre or extreme' sports such as hubcap throwing, wife-carrying and extreme ironing as well as the more 'mainstream' material such as the biographical footage of top sportspeople.

"It is a very good fit with our existing service," said APTN's Head of Content Development Chris O'Hearn. "We believe that the type of clients who come to APTN for news and entertainment will be interested in SNTV's sport as well," he added.

Sports News Television (SNTV) claims to be the world's leading sports news agency, and is a partnership between the Associated Press and Trans World International (TWI).
